About this Association

The Society of British Jewellers is the UK's professional body that markets and supports new, intermediate and experienced jewellery makers and jewellery designers throughout the British Isles. The SBJ promotes the talent and creativity of these jewellery craftspeople to consumers around the UK. Whether you are looking to have a new unique item of jewellery designed and made just for you or wish an heirloom remodelled into something that you can enjoy daily, the SBJ presents you with the right people in your area with whom you can work.

Membership

The Society of British Jewellers has an active membership that is open to anyone who has a keen interest in any part of the jewellery trade and wants to share there skills and knowledge to help others within the industry.

The SBJ can present your work portfolio on their website that is regularly updated to keep it fresh. There are also opportunities to showcase yourself as a 'Featured Jeweller' on the website to present your skills to consumers. The SBJ supports jewellers Social Media activity by sharing posts to their various public websites.

Benfits

Being a full member of the SBJ has many benefits:

  • Preferential rates on society events
  • Access to closed forums for discussion on topics that affect the Artisan Jeweller
  • Discounts from many product suppliers and service providers
  • Digital SBJ badge, membership card and certificate

Structure

  • Identity: Unincorporated Association
  • Managed By: An Individual
  • Parent Entity: Automonous
  • Inception: 2015

Disciplines

  • Jewellery (primary)
  • Gemmology
  • Appraisal
  • Retail Jeweller Support
  • Horology

Membership

  • Trade only
  • Home Country & International
  • Number Members: 200-499
  • Min Member Fee: £100

Education

  • Courses Available: No
  • Topics: Gemmology, Jewellery, Appraisal, Horology, Marketing
